Dimensions of a Twin Bed
A standard twin bed measures 38 inches in width and 75 inches in length. This makes it a popular choice for single sleepers, as it provides enough space for a comfortable night's sleep without taking up too much room in a bedroom.
Twin XL Bed Dimensions
In addition to the standard twin bed, there is also a twin XL bed size. A twin XL bed is 5 inches longer than a standard twin, making it a better option for taller sleepers. The width of a twin XL bed remains the same as a standard twin, at 38 inches.
Benefits of a Twin Bed
There are several benefits to choosing a twin bed as your bed of choice. Some of these benefits include:
- Space-saving: Twin beds are a great option for small bedrooms, as they do not take up as much space as larger bed sizes.
- Affordability: Twin beds are typically less expensive than larger bed sizes, making them a budget-friendly option.
- Versatility: Twin beds can be used in a variety of settings, such as guest rooms, children's rooms, and main bedrooms.
Drawbacks of a Twin Bed
While there are many benefits to choosing a twin bed, there are also some drawbacks to consider. These include:
- Limited space: Twin beds are not suitable for couples, as they do not provide enough space for two people to comfortably sleep.
- Not ideal for tall sleepers: Standard twin beds may not be long enough for taller sleepers, which can lead to discomfort during the night.
